Children 5-9 years of age have the highest number of dental emergencies every year. More than 600,000 people visit an emergency room annually from sports-related dental injuries. Between 3 to 5 million teeth are knocked out every year from sports. An athletic mouthguard is a simple way to safeguard your child\u2019s smile. If you have a young athlete, here\u2019s when your child should wear a mouthguard.<\/p>\n<p><!--more--><\/p>\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\">Protect Your Child\u2019s Smile<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p>Athletes who don\u2019t wear mouthguards are 60 times more likely to suffer a dental emergency. A custom-fit mouthguard provides a layer of protection for your little one\u2019s teeth and gums. It can also prevent jaw injuries and lessen the severity of concussions.&nbsp;<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>You wouldn&#8217;t send your child onto the football field without a helmet. Every mouth is as unique as fingerprints, which means there&#8217;s no one-size-fits-all mouthguard. If it doesn\u2019t fit correctly, it can increase your child&#8217;s risk of oral injuries.&nbsp;<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Boil-to-fit OTC mouthguards aren&#8217;t any safer. Although they may provide a better fit than other options, they aren&#8217;t made of the best materials, which could limit the protection they offer.&nbsp;<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Instead, take your little one to their pediatric dentist for a custom-fit athletic mouthguard. It will be made of durable, comfortable material to fit their mouth like a glove.&nbsp;<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Be sure your child cleans their mouthguard after every use to remove plaque buildup and bacteria. Regular cleaning will keep their mouth healthy and prolong the lifespan of their mouthguard.&nbsp;<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>You can ensure your child is prepared for the upcoming season.
